How are disciplinary antecedents addressed in the Argentine educational field?

In Argentina, in the educational field, disciplinary records are managed by educational institutions. They can conduct internal investigations, collect information from previous teachers and apply disciplinary measures according to their own regulations.

What is considered terrorism in Colombia and what are the associated penalties?

Terrorism in Colombia refers to the carrying out of violent, intimidating or destructive acts with the aim of causing terror in the population, destabilizing public order or influencing State policies. This crime is severely punished under Colombian law and the associated penalties can include criminal legal actions, long prison sentences, fines and administrative sanctions.

What is the regulation of visits in Chile and how is it established?

Visitation regulation refers to the visitation rights of a non-custodial parent. It is established by agreement of the parties or by judicial decision, considering the interest of the minor.
